Analysis
The most recent figure for renewable natural capital per capita, nonwood forest protection in Tunisia is 9.8 current US$, measured in 2020.
That represents a change of up 8.1% on the previous year and up 11.6% over ten years.
Over the whole period, renewable natural capital per capita, nonwood forest protection in Tunisia peaked at 12.37 current US$ in 2005 and was at its lowest, 8.04 current US$, in 2014.
Tunisia ranks 134th of 149 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.
The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 26 years of available data.
